Thanks EAdams.
Yes, the blending mode used in the Bomber is "Difference" so, depending on the original and selected colors, the results can be completely different. If you choose to have only squares in the first Set ( or if you choose the third Set with only the first type of squares ), the result is similar to a tech or greeble surface.
